July sees major increase in flights as aviation authority eases ban

By The Nation

 

800_1924e0079572cd9.jpg?v=1597996822

 

Air traffic volume in July exceeded 27,000 flights after the Civil Aviation Authority of Thailand (CAAT) allowed airlines to operate flights across the nation, the Aeronautical Radio of Thailand (Aerothai) said on Friday (August 21).

 

Previously, the CAAT had announced a temporary ban on flights from April 3 this year to deal with the Covid-19 pandemic.

 

After the Covid-19 situation was contained, the CAAT allowed airlines to operate flights across the nation in May and some international flights after permission was given in July, causing air traffic volume to increase.

 

Air traffic volume in July this year totalled 27,639 flights, comprising 3,711 international flights, 14,054 domestic flights, 1,991 flights across Thai airspace and 7,883 military and government flights, Aerothai said.

Because the press release is from Aeronautical Radio of Thailand (Aerothai), the state enterprise that handles air traffic control and aeronautical navigation and communication for Thailand. From their perspective, overflights and military flights create just as much work for them as commercial flights. The fact that statistics about those other flights is of zero interest to people outside of their company is of no interest to them or to the "journalists" who copy and paste their PR releases without critical comment.
